EST. 1945

The Dallas Chamber Music Society, established in 1945 as the Elmer Scott Concert Series, was incorporated ten years later by Dorothea and Bartram Kelley as The Dallas Chamber Music Society. The Society has presented the world’s most respected chamber ensembles since its origin and continues this legacy of excellence today.
